当前位置:首页经验技巧Excel经验excel函数

电子表格一个excel大文件怎么分成多个文件

2024-07-20 15:09:37

1.一个excel大文件怎么分成多个文件

vba,建10个文件流,一行一行的读数据,读到哪个部门的就写到对应的文件里面。

牵扯到的步骤比较多,而且你如果你不会编程的话讲了也没用。

Sub CreateAfile Set fs = CreateObject("Scripting.FileSystemObject") '建立文件系统对象 Set a = fs.CreateTextFile("c:\testfile.txt", True) '建文件流 a.WriteLine("This is a test.") '写文本行 a.Close '关闭文件流End Sub这是一个最简单的写text文件的操作。

2.如何把一个excel拆分多个文件夹

1、打开需要编辑的Excel文档。工作簿下方有很多工作表。现在需要将这些工作表单独拆分开成一个个工作簿。

2、右键任意一个工作表标签,在弹出的下拉列表中选择查看代码。即弹出代码窗口。

3、点击菜单插入-模块 在弹出的模块对话框中 输入以下代码:

4、单击运行-运行子过程|窗体 几秒过后 弹出提示窗口“文件已被拆分完毕”

5、返回Excel工作簿文件所在路径 查看 原先工作簿中的工作表已经成为单独的工作簿了!不信 可以对照查看图中的修改日期

3.请教怎么把一个excel文件按条件分割成多个文件

1、首先将分公司欠款汇总表做成数据透视表,插入-数据透视表。

2、选择在新工作表,或者是现有工作表,然后点确定。

3、得到数据透视表,然后用鼠标选择区域放在报表筛选。

4、其他几项放在行标签。

5、然后在选项-选项-显示报表筛选项,点击显示报表筛选项。

6、然后出现显示报表筛选页,其中选定要显示的报表筛选页字段为区域。

7、点击确定后,分公司欠款明细就自动显示出来。

4.如何把在一个excel表格里的表分成多个文件

Alt+F11 视图--代码窗口,把如下复制进去按F5运行即可最好把这个Excel 放到一个文件夹内操作, 因为默认生成到当前文件夹

1

2

3

4

5

6

7

8

9

10

11

Subfencun()

Application.ScreenUpdating = False

Foreach sht in thisworkbook.sheets

sht.copy

WithActiveWorkbook

.SaveAs Filename:=ThisWorkbook.Path & "\" & sht.name & ".xlsx"

.Close True

EndWith

Next

Application.ScreenUpdating = true

EndSub


电脑版

免责声明:本站信息来自网络收集及网友投稿,仅供参考,如果有错误请反馈给我们更正,对文中内容的真实性和完整性本站不提供任何保证,不承但任何责任,谢谢您的合作。
版权所有:五学知识网 Copyright © 2015-2024 All Rights Reserved .